# Retrieve custom provider

Retrieve a specific custom provider by its primary key ID.

<Note>
  **Sensitive fields**: The `api_key` and `extra_kwargs` fields are never returned in API responses for security reasons.
</Note>

## Path parameters

<ParamField path="pk" type="integer" required>
  The provider's primary key ID (numeric database ID).

  <Accordion title="Example">
    ```
    123
    ```
  </Accordion>
</ParamField>

## Response

Returns the provider object without sensitive fields.

<ResponseExample>
  ```json 200 OK theme={"system"}
  {
    "id": "my-azure-provider",
    "provider_id": "my-azure-provider",
    "provider_name": "My Azure Provider",
    "created_at": "2024-01-15T10:30:00Z",
    "updated_at": "2024-01-15T10:30:00Z"
  }
  ```

  ```json 404 Not Found theme={"system"}
  {
    "detail": "Not found."
  }
  ```

  ```json 401 Unauthorized theme={"system"}
  {
    "detail": "Authentication credentials were not provided."
  }
  ```
</ResponseExample>

<RequestExample>
  ```python Python theme={"system"}
  import requests

  provider_pk = 123
  url = f"https://api.keywordsai.co/api/providers/{provider_pk}/"
  headers = {
      "Authorization": "Bearer YOUR_API_KEY"
  }

  response = requests.get(url, headers=headers)
  print(response.json())
  ```

  ```typescript TypeScript theme={"system"}
  const providerPk = 123;
  const url = `https://api.keywordsai.co/api/providers/${providerPk}/`;
  const headers = {
      'Authorization': 'Bearer YOUR_API_KEY'
  };

  const response = await fetch(url, {
      method: 'GET',
      headers: headers
  });

  const data = await response.json();
  console.log(data);
  ```

  ```bash cURL theme={"system"}
  curl "https://api.keywordsai.co/api/providers/123/" \
    -H "Authorization: Bearer YOUR_API_KEY"
  ```
</RequestExample>
